The native of Queens, New York made a rare appearance on Instagram Live on September 21 with a comment by DJ Akademiks. LL accused the 31-year-old YouTuber of labeling the veteran rapper “dirty” for not flaunting their money. In his lengthy response, the founder of Rock The Bells did not mention Ak, but his message was definitely directed at him.
LL stated, “Just because [hip-hop pioneers] did not gain millions or billions of wealth does not mean that they did not contribute to culture.” “They have established an industry that we have all consumed. They have established a self-sustaining enterprise.”
As one of the most prominent individuals in the hip-hop media, Akademiks is accustomed to getting criticism for his provocative views on rap-related matters. However, it is not often that the OG strain kicks things into overdrive.
“I’m only concerned about obtaining the paper,” LL concluded. “I’ve been talking about it my entire career. But never mix affluence with cultural contribution. No longer play like that!”
